Be Informed & Prepared
Think of your doula as your childbirth encyclopedia. Avoid endless hours googling, your doula will guide you to reliable, evidence-based sources.
During our prenatal visits together we cover the ins and outs of childbirth to prepare you for a positive birth experience. Skills and techniques we teach include, but are not limited to, spinning babies, acupressure, counter-pressure, massage, labor & birthing positioning for comfort and guiding baby into optimal position, diaphragmatic breathing, mindfulness meditation, and visualizations. These approaches are useful in both unmedicated AND medicated labors and births. Your birth partner, if you choose to have one, will have the opportunity to learn and practice various ways of supporting.
You will also be prepared to confidently tackle the postpartum period. Our time together during the final prenatal visit focuses heavily on preparing for parenthood.
